Principal Reasons and Stages of Tajiks` Emigration beyond their Motherland Baundaries

Avtors

Ismoilova Bisaboat

Abstract

The article dwells on the principal reasons and stages of Tajiks` emigration, about 40 men Tajiks live now beyong the boundaries of contemporary Tajikistan; the figure increasing seven times the number of Tajiks living in RT. Emigration of Tajiks beyond the  boundaries  of their motherland began since times immemorial being divided into two periods. The first period consists of  five  stages.

Each wave of Tajiks` emigration has its own reasons: invasion of Arabs in the  middle of the VII-th century, advent of Turkic-speaking dynasties to power, intrusion of Mongols, wars inside dynasties. The second period began in the 20-ieth of the XX-th century and has been going on up to nowadays. Its initial stage was associated with the activities of the Soviet state,  the next ones being preconditioned with the civil war of 1992-1997 and labour migration.
